How Many Apartments Actually Have Cockroaches?

cockroach prevalence in apartments

Depending on where you look, somewhere between 28% and 77% of apartments have cockroaches — a range wide enough to seem contradictory until you understand what’s driving it.

Standard apartment surveys cluster in the high-20s to high-30s percent range. A Rutgers survey found cockroaches in 30% of 344 apartments. A separate national apartment-complex survey landed at 28%.

A 2022 study of 1,753 apartments across 19 buildings found cockroaches in 37% of units.

The numbers climb sharply in public and high-density urban housing. A New York City public-housing study found cockroach evidence in 76% of apartments, with 35% trapping more than 100 cockroaches per week in kitchens alone.

Inner-city apartment studies have reported rates as high as 77%. German cockroaches are the most common indoor species worldwide and are the primary driver behind infestations in multi-unit residential buildings.

Cockroach Infestation Rates in Low-Income Apartments

high cockroach rates persist

Low-income apartments consistently show higher cockroach infestation rates than general apartment surveys suggest. Across multiple studies, rates ranged from 28% to 49%, with one building reporting 63% of units affected at some point.

Study TypeInfestation RateKey Detail
Multi-building survey37%1,753 apartments across 19 buildings
Low-income trapping study49%Based on trap catches
Sampled apartment study30%German cockroaches confirmed
Public housing inspection28%Visual inspection method
Building-wide study47% baseline63% affected over time

German cockroaches drive nearly all of these infestations, appearing in 97.8% of cockroach-positive apartments. You’ll find them concentrated in kitchens and bathrooms, where moisture and food are accessible.

Structural conditions amplify your risk considerably. Peeling paint raises infestation odds by 3.8 times, poor sanitation by 2.7 times, and water damage by 1.9 times — making housing quality a direct predictor of cockroach presence.

Shared Walls Spread Infestations

Unlike single-family homes, apartments share walls, ceilings, and floors that connect your unit directly to your neighbors’—and cockroaches exploit every gap in that shared structure. They move through wall voids, plumbing stacks, electrical conduits, and pipe collars without restriction.

Research confirms this pattern: after coordinated building-wide treatment, correlations among infestations in wall-sharing units dropped considerably by six months and disappeared entirely by twelve months.

Shared PathwayWhy It Matters
Plumbing penetrationsDirect routes between stacked units
Electrical conduitsHidden corridors behind walls
Wall voids and gapsContinuous movement across multiple units

Treating only your apartment won’t stop reinfestation if adjacent units remain active. Sealing outlet boxes, pipe collars, and wall penetrations—combined with coordinated neighbor treatment—is what actually interrupts the spread. Studies estimate that up to 30% of a building’s cockroach population may move between apartments within a single week, making neighbor-level activity a direct threat to your unit regardless of your own hygiene.

Dense Living Enables Migration

Shared walls explain part of why cockroaches spread so easily between units—but the structure of apartment buildings as a whole makes migration even harder to stop.

Dense occupancy concentrates plumbing, electrical conduits, and utility chases into a compact space, giving cockroaches low-resistance routes throughout the entire building. When conditions in one unit change—say, after treatment—roaches don’t disappear. They relocate.

One building-level report found that up to 30% of a cockroach population can move between apartments in a single week.

Shared trash rooms, compactor areas, and kitchen-heavy layouts give roaches the food, moisture, and harborage they need to survive once they’ve migrated.

In a detached home, an infestation stays contained. In an apartment building, it rarely does. During summer months, elevated temperatures above 70°F accelerate cockroach reproduction, meaning migrating populations can establish new infestations in neighboring units far faster than residents or landlords can respond.

Urban Settings Increase Exposure

Apartment buildings sit at the center of cockroach exposure risk, and urban density is a big reason why. Studies show elevated cockroach allergen concentrations in 78% to 98% of urban homes, compared to 63% overall. High-rise apartments consistently show the highest prevalence in population-level research.

Urban apartments concentrate the conditions cockroaches need most: warmth, humidity, food access, and harborage sites. Shared plumbing creates recurring moisture, wall voids allow movement between units, and background infestation pressure across dense neighborhoods keeps reinfestation likely even after treatment.

If you live in a multiunit building, your odds of cockroach exposure are measurably higher than someone in a detached home. One study found apartments carried an odds ratio of 3.0 for infestation compared to single-family housing. Older buildings built pre-1940 and those showing signs of disrepair, such as peeling paint and active leaks, carry an even greater risk of sustained infestation.

Trap Counts Per Week

Sticky trap data from apartment studies reveals just how wide the range of cockroach activity can be inside a single unit.

Researchers typically place sticky traps in kitchens for 7 to 14 days, then standardize results to weekly totals. Counts of 0–10 per week suggest light to moderate activity, while 11–50 signals a clearly established infestation.

Once you reach 51–100 per week, you’re looking at a strong infestation load with real spread risk. Above 100 per week qualifies as heavy, and it’s more common than you’d expect—one major study found 15.5% of apartments exceeding that threshold.

At the extreme end, one apartment produced a two-week catch of 1,385 cockroaches across six traps, showing just how severe these situations can get.

Daily Sighting Reports

Trap counts tell one part of the story, but what residents actually see day to day makes the scale of a heavy infestation harder to ignore.

In one apartment study, 39.1% of residents reported seeing 1–9 cockroaches daily, while 41.2% reported seeing 10 or more every single day. That’s not occasional—that’s a sustained, visible population.

Heavy infestations follow recognizable patterns.

You’ll notice multiple roaches scattering when you turn on the kitchen lights, which signals overcrowding since cockroaches are naturally nocturnal. Daytime sightings reinforce that.

Add droppings along baseboards, egg cases in cabinets, nymphs moving alongside adults, and a musty odor, and you’re looking at an active, growing colony—not a stray visitor passing through.

Hidden Allergen Reservoirs

What you see scattering across the floor is only part of the problem. Even after live cockroaches disappear, dead bodies, fecal droppings, and shed fragments keep releasing allergens into your dust and air. These particles don’t vanish on their own.

They settle into mattresses, upholstered furniture, kitchen floors, cabinet drawers, and narrow cracks around appliances. Kitchens consistently carry the heaviest allergen loads, but your bedroom isn’t safe either.

Studies have detected cockroach allergens in bedroom air and beds, not just kitchen surfaces. Clutter and poor sanitation can raise airborne allergen levels by up to 11-fold.

Holes in walls push kitchen concentrations even higher. If cleaning is incomplete, these reservoirs keep exposing you long after the infestation appears to be gone.

You Can Have Cockroach Allergen Without Seeing a Single Roach

hidden allergens in dust

Even if you haven’t spotted a single cockroach, allergen from their shed skin, droppings, and body parts can still be building up in your home’s dust.

Kitchen and floor dust act as long-term reservoirs, holding allergen long after roach activity has dropped.

Research shows that allergen levels in dust track cockroach counts from two months earlier, not just current activity.

Dust allergen levels reflect cockroach activity from two months ago, not what’s happening in your home right now.

So even if pest control has reduced visible roaches, your dust can still carry measurable exposure.

That said, allergen presence isn’t guaranteed everywhere.

Studies in Croatian homes found Bla g 2 undetectable in many samples, and only 4 of 30 Zagreb households had detectable Bla g 1.

Exposure varies widely between homes.

The key takeaway is that you can’t rely on visual checks alone.

Dust testing reveals hidden exposure that sightings miss, and cleaning combined with pest control is what actually reduces allergen levels over time.

Why Cockroaches Are Especially Dangerous for Asthma Sufferers

cockroach allergens exacerbate asthma

Cockroach allergens don’t just trigger sneezing—they can drive serious, recurring asthma that’s harder to control and more likely to land you in the hospital. If you’re sensitized and regularly exposed, your risk jumps considerably.

Studies show children with both positive cockroach skin tests and high bedroom exposure had the worst asthma outcomes of any group measured.

The numbers are striking. Exposure to Bla g 1 levels above 2 U/g was linked to an adjusted odds ratio of 4.2 for hospitalization. Levels above 8 U/g were tied to the highest morbidity in inner-city studies.

Beyond hospitalizations, you’re also looking at more emergency visits, more missed school days, and more nights lost to symptoms.

What makes apartments particularly risky is that allergen lingers for months after roaches are gone. You can reduce the infestation and still face ongoing exposure from residue that’s already settled into your home.

Can Cockroaches Spread Illness Beyond Triggering Asthma and Allergic Reactions?

Yes, cockroaches can spread illness beyond asthma and allergies. They’ll carry bacteria like *Salmonella* and *E. coli* on their bodies, contaminating your food and surfaces, which can lead to foodborne and gastrointestinal diseases.

How Quickly Can a Small Cockroach Problem Turn Into a Full Infestation?

A small cockroach problem can explode into a full infestation within weeks. If you’ve spotted one or two German cockroaches, you’re already racing against a population that can reach thousands within just a few months.

Are Certain Apartment Types or Building Ages More Likely to Have Cockroaches?

Yes, you’re at higher risk if you live in a high-rise, multifamily building, or pre-1940 construction. Older buildings with cracked walls, leaking pipes, and poor maintenance consistently show the highest cockroach infestation rates.

What Should a Renter Do if a Landlord Ignores a Cockroach Complaint?

Document everything, send a written notice via certified mail, and set a deadline for action. If your landlord still ignores you, escalate to local code enforcement or consult a tenant-rights attorney before withholding rent.

Do Cockroach Problems Typically Get Worse During Certain Seasons of the Year?

Yes, cockroach problems do get worse in certain seasons. You’ll likely see the most activity in summer when heat and humidity spike. Spring and fall also bring increased movement, while winter concentrates them near your warm pipes and appliances.
